Sensex Drops 204 Points, Nifty Falls 40 in Weak Asian Trade

Early trade on Monday dropped for equity benchmark indices under effect of negative trends in Asian markets and ongoing foreign money outflows. Early trade settled the 30-share BSE Sensex at 79,612.21 after it declined 204.39 points. The Nifty dropped 40.75 points at the same time to score 24,283.10 points. “SEBI vs. Hindenburg: Controversial Show-Cause Notice Ignites Debate”

Regarding its accusations against the Adani Group, Hindenburg Research has received a show-cause notice from the Securities and Exchange Board of India (SEBI). The Indian multinational was previously accused of illegal activities and manipulating share prices by the US-based short seller. Stanley Lifestyles IPO Success: Hold or Sell?

Incredible Market Entry On Dalal Street Friday, Stanley Lifestyles Ltd. launched luxury furnishings. Company shares were listed on the Bombay Stock Exchange (BSE) at ₹499 per share, 35.23% more than its issue price of ₹369. On NSE, the shares began trading at ₹494.95, a 34.13% premium.
